4.5.2External Resistor

Connect an external resistor between terminal J2/3 (ECLP) and terminal J2/2 (ECLRET). The resistor value is given by:

RECLP (Kohm) = 12.5 * Ip(new) - 1

Ip(nom)

0 < RECLP < 11.4 K (1/8 Watt)

At RECLP greater than 11.4K, the current limit will be internally clamped to the nominal value.

IP(nom) is the nominal peak current limit of the amplifier.

4.6Latch Mode (LM)

By connecting J2/7 to J2/8, the amplifier can be latched to Disable mode whenever a Short or Over Temperature failure occurs. Disabling the amplifier temporarily (removing the power from Enable pins J2/9 and J2/10) resets the latch. Be sure to restore the Enable connection when the reason for the event no longer exists. For permanent selection, a simple short is recommended. For remote selection, use the following scheme.

4.7Amplifier Enable Logic

Pins J2/9 and J2/10 are the inputs of an opto-coupler, which must be energized to enable operation of the amplifier. If the Enable input is kept high before turning on the amplifier, the amplifier power output will be active immediately upon power on.
